NEW YORK - The Africa Travel Association (ATA) announced the election of its new board of directors. The board was elected on May 21 at ATA's 37th Annual World Congress inVictoria Falls,Zimbabwe.

ATA government members elected Zimbabwe Tourism and Hospitality Industry Minister, Eng. Walter Mzembi, as the new president of the association. Other governments elected to the board includeCentral African Republic,Egypt,Ethiopia,Ghana,Tanzania,Uganda,ZambiaandZimbabwe.

Minister Mzembi succeeds Honorable Fatou Mass Jobe-Njie, The Gambia Minister of Tourism and Culture, who served as ATA’s president from May 2010 to May 2012. During Minister Jobe-Njie’s tenure, ATA country membership grew significantly, along with high-level government participation and industry attendance at ATA’s annual tourism events in theUnited States, particularly ATA Presidential Forum on Tourism inNew Yorkand the U.S.-Africa Tourism Seminar inWashington,D.C.
